Respecto a una MACRO en excel ¿Cómo ejecutar una macro debusqueda debajo de otra?

Tengo una base de datos, con extensa información por ende aplique una macro para filtrar de manera sumamente básica la info en base al rut, hasta ahí todo bien, mi problema surge que como es tanta la info, abarca varias columnas hacia la derecha por ende para tener la información de manera más cómoda pongo unos datos en una fila y debajo de la misma, otros datos, y quiero que amba información se filtre y se muestre al ejecutar una sola macro la información solicitada

Por lo cual aplique dos macros y las intento unir en una sola, sin embargo al aplicarlas, como esta debajo la una de a otra, me borra la información y me da error, sin lograr ejecutarla.

He leído un poco en internet y creo que mi problema radica en no tener algunos parámetros asociados al limite de copia y pegar en la primera macro.

Bueno, estoy medio perdido.

1

1 respuesta

Respuesta
2

H o l a:

Te anexo la macro actualizada

Sub Filtrar()
'Act.Por.Dante Amor
    Sheets("BD").Cells.AdvancedFilter Action:=xlFilterCopy, _
        CriteriaRange:=Range("B3:B4"), CopyToRange:=Range("B7:G8"), Unique:=False
    Sheets("BD").Cells.AdvancedFilter Action:=xlFilterCopy, _
        CriteriaRange:=Range("B3:B4"), CopyToRange:=Range("B11:I12"), Unique:=False
End Sub

El detalle es que la primera macro borraba los encabezados del segundo filtro. Faltaba indicar que el rango destino solamente sea de B7 a G8.


' : )
'S aludos. Dante Amor. Recuerda valorar la respuesta. G racias
' : )

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as